A Journey Through Canada’s Mountain Rail History

The Revelstoke Railway Museum is one of the city's most cherished heritage attractions, offering visitors an engaging look at the history of Canada’s transcontinental railway and the people who built it. Located in the heart of Revelstoke, the museum preserves the story of how the Canadian Pacific Railway (CPR) shaped the region, connected the country, and influenced the growth of communities throughout British Columbia. With authentic locomotives, historic artifacts, interactive exhibits, and detailed displays, the museum provides a fascinating experience for families, history lovers, and railway enthusiasts.

The Revelstoke Railway Museum showcases the rich railway heritage of the Columbia Mountains and the crucial role Revelstoke played in Canadian rail history. The exhibits trace the development of the CPR through rugged terrain, highlighting the engineering achievements, challenges, and dedication of the workers who helped link Canada from coast to coast.

Visitors can explore beautifully preserved rolling stock, including a steam locomotive and caboose, as well as interpretive galleries explaining mountain rail operations, snow removal methods, and life on the railway.

Highlights of Revelstoke Railway Museum

1. Historic Steam Locomotive

One of the museum’s most impressive features is the fully restored CPR steam locomotive, which provides an up-close look at the power and engineering that helped shape early railway transportation in Canada.

2. Caboose & Rolling Stock

Step inside vintage rail cars and learn how train crews lived and worked during long journeys through mountain passes.

3. Interactive Exhibits

Hands-on displays cover topics such as railway communication, snowplow operations, track building, and the challenges of maintaining rail service through the mountains.

4. Model Railway Display

A detailed model train layout depicts historic routes, mountain terrain, and rail operations, making it a favourite among visitors of all ages.
